Oh, you actually wanted the information??? ;>)

Grant Richter is finishing up a new eprom designed for Bank B for the 
Blacet MiniWave. Here's a summary:

Bank  0: Peak Clipping
Bank  1: Base Clipping
Bank  2: Too Much Gain
Bank  3: Too Little Gain
Bank  4: Powers of m = 1 to 5
Bank  5: Powers of m = 1 to 0.2
Bank  6: Bit Decimation
Bank  7: Rectification
Bank  8: ESQ Wonderland #1
Bank  9: ESQ Wonderland #2
Bank 10: ESQ Wonderland #3
Bank 11: ESQ Wonderland #4
Bank 12: MARF Discriminator (voltage aperture / pulse outs)
Bank 13: Morse Code Loops 16 Beat
Bank 14: Morse Code Loops 32 Beat
Bank 15: Prayer Wheels (Buddhist, Hindu, Sanskrit, Bible, etc.)

Some pretty wild stuff. You can download a preliminary document here:

http://groups.yahoo.com/group/wiardgroup/files/Marf4_Manual.pdf

I haven't heard of any availability or price info yet.
